Output feaef86259a143999bcc36eec48e552bbea7868a5f584090230ee6c2e7791d8e:7

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9bcf5a0164d16a1546ec3363b4c8c63a494d7cf OP_EQUALVERIFY OP_CHECKSIG
address
DSSzM68piAj3i891KaSxhXNC2tcQM8DG8Z
transaction
feaef86259a143999bcc36eec48e552bbea7868a5f584090230ee6c2e7791d8e